Conditions of Participation
“Begehungen 2012“ is organised by the non-profit society Begehungen e.V.
In order to take part in the event you need to fill in the online application form until May 20, 2012. Please enclose no more than five samples of your work with your application.Please note the requirements for your digital attachments: Size max 10 MB; Resolution max. 2000x2000 pixel; Format: JPEG. The applicant certifies that he is the creator of the work(s) submitted.
Artists who work in the following sectors are invited to apply: painting, graphic, sculpture, photography, performance, audio visual, digital art, street art, installation. Other forms of art might be suitable but are subject to accreditation by the organisers. All of the submitted artworks should address the general topic.
All applications will be evaluated by an assigned jury. The jury is to decide the number and formation of the finalists. Applicants will know by the end of June whether they have been selected or not. An individual statement of justification will not be issued.
No charges or fees for renting etc. will incur during the festival. Unfortunately, the organisers are not able to pay for any production or installation costs. Technical support and tools can only be made available in justified exceptional cases and only if an e-mail is sent to us early enough in advance.
by August 15, 2012 at the latest, all works of art should be installed by the artist in person. At least seven days after the end of the exhibition, the artwork also needs to be removed. It is of great benefit, if every artist could personally attend the exhibition in order to support the dialogue between visitors and all the other artists present at the exhibition. Furthermore, we cannot guarantee a permanent supervision of your artwork throughout the festival. Therefore, we ask every artist to supervise his/her exhibition space on their own or through a personally assigned representative.
The organiser will provide the exhibition space and also prepare and display the labelling of the artwork. Each exhibition space will be assigned by the organiser. Any artist with special requirements is asked to get in touch with the organiser early enough in advance to negotiate any further possibilities. As concerning the labelling of the artwork, every artist is asked to submit all necessary information at least 15 working days in advance.
The organisers cannot be made liable in case of theft of the artworks, theft of technical equipment of the participants, for occurring risks during (de)installation, for transportation problems, and damage that is caused by fluctuation of current during the festival.
All participating artists authorise the organiser to record, publish, save and distribute photographs of the artworks and personal details of the artist for: Public Relation purposes, press and media coverage, documentation, catalogue of the exhibition, posters etc. In any case the organiser will adhere to the copyright.
